Frugality is next to godliness,
but only for spendthrifts. For us frugal types, paying LIST PRICE is next to godliness — what repentance looks like for us, because we get so much artificial LIFE — fake worthiness, human-wisdom-worthiness, from a good deal, instead of being content with Jesus and His imputed worthiness. Excruciatingly painful for us frugal types to pay list price, or even average price. Pride, not humility. Obsessing over brilliant purchasing decisions.
I’m not saying frugal types are sinning if we don’t pay list price. I’m saying when the Spirit convicts us of our bargain idolatry, CONFESS. Rather than imagining we’re as wonderful as our human-wisdom would have us believe.
